在这个智能化的时代,智能门铃已经成为了许多家庭的新宠。叮咚门铃作为市场上的一款热门产品,不仅功能强大,而且支持用户自定义编程,让门铃变得更加个性化。今天,就让我们一起探索如何掌握叮咚门铃编程,轻松打造属于你自己的智能门铃。
一、叮咚门铃简介
叮咚门铃是一款集成了语音通话、视频监控、访客提醒等功能的智能门铃。它可以通过Wi-Fi连接到用户的手机,实现远程监控和控制。同时,叮咚门铃还支持自定义编程,让用户可以根据自己的需求进行个性化设置。
二、叮咚门铃编程基础
1. 下载叮咚门铃APP
首先,您需要在手机上下载叮咚门铃APP,并完成注册和设备绑定。在APP中,您可以查看门铃的状态、接收访客提醒、进行语音通话等。
2. 学习编程语言
叮咚门铃的编程主要基于JavaScript语言。如果您是编程新手,可以先从基础的语法和概念开始学习。以下是一些常用的编程概念:
- 变量:用于存储数据,如访客姓名、门铃铃声等。
- 函数:用于执行特定任务,如播放音乐、发送通知等。
- 条件语句:用于根据条件执行不同的操作,如访客到达时播放特定音乐。
3. 编程环境
叮咚门铃的编程环境可以在APP中找到。在编程界面,您可以使用拖拽的方式添加代码块,或者直接编写代码。
三、个性化编程案例
1. 欢迎访客
当有访客按下门铃时,您可以让叮咚门铃播放一段欢迎音乐。以下是一个简单的示例代码:
// 定义欢迎音乐
var welcomeMusic = "https://example.com/welcome.mp3";
// 当门铃被按下时,播放音乐
if (doorbellPressed) {
playMusic(welcomeMusic);
}
2. 自动开启灯光
当夜幕降临,您可以让叮咚门铃自动开启家中的灯光。以下是一个简单的示例代码:
// 定义灯光控制函数
function turnOnLights() {
// 发送指令到智能家居设备,开启灯光
// ...
}
// 当夜幕降临,调用函数开启灯光
if (nightTime) {
turnOnLights();
}
3. 远程控制家电
您还可以通过叮咚门铃远程控制家中的家电,如空调、电视等。以下是一个简单的示例代码:
// 定义家电控制函数
function controlAppliance(applianceName, command) {
// 发送指令到智能家居设备,执行操作
// ...
}
// 当需要控制家电时,调用函数
controlAppliance("空调", "开启");
四、总结
掌握叮咚门铃编程,可以让您的智能门铃变得更加个性化。通过学习JavaScript语言和编程技巧,您可以轻松实现各种功能,让生活更加便捷。希望本文能帮助您入门叮咚门铃编程,打造属于自己的智能门铃。
